Natalie L. Wisco is best known for her role as a defense attorney in the high-profile Kyle Rittenhouse trial, where she successfully secured Not Guilty verdicts on all charges. Her trial record is exceptional; in 2023 alone, she took seven cases to a jury, resulting in five instances of being acquitted on one or more counts.

Her trial experience spans nearly all state criminal cases, but she is also a formidable Federal Criminal Defense advocate, handling complex matters including fraud, terrorism, firearms, and drug conspiracies in federal trial court.

Expertise in Criminal Appeals and Client Advocacy

Beyond the courtroom, Attorney Wisco dedicates significant time to Criminal Appeals, achieving early successes where the state conceded her arguments.

Licensed in Wisconsin State Court, the U.S. District Court for the Eastern District of Wisconsin, and the Seventh Circuit Court of Appeals, Natalie represents clients across the state facing charges from drug offenses and firearms offenses to assault, financial crimes, and CHIPS actions. A Marquette Law graduate, she prioritizes clear communication, ensuring clients understand every procedural and substantive aspect of their defense.
